static Node *parse_while_statement(Context *ctx)
{
assert(ctx != NULL);
if(done(ctx))
{
Error_Report(ctx->error, 0, "Source ended where a while statement was expected");
return NULL;
}
if(current(ctx) != TKWWHILE)
{
Error_Report(ctx->error, 0, "Got unexpected token \"%.*s\" where a while statement was expected", ctx->token->length, ctx->src + ctx->token->offset);
return NULL;
}
Token *while_token = current_token(ctx);
assert(while_token != NULL);
next(ctx); // Consume the "while" keyword.
Node *condition = parse_expression(ctx);
if(condition == NULL)
return NULL;
if(done(ctx))
{
Error_Report(ctx->error, 0, "Source ended right after a while loop condition, where a ':' was expected");
return NULL;
}
if(current(ctx) != ':')
{
Error_Report(ctx->error, 0, "Got unexpected token \"%.*s\" after a while loop condition, where a ':' was expected", ctx->token->length, ctx->src + ctx->token->offset);
return NULL;
}
next(ctx); // Skip the ':'.
Node *body = parse_statement(ctx);
if(body == NULL)
return NULL;
WhileNode *whl;
{
whl = BPAlloc_Malloc(ctx->alloc, sizeof(WhileNode));
if(whl == NULL)
{
// ERROR: No memory.
Error_Report(ctx->error, 1, "No memory");
return NULL;
}
whl->base.kind = NODE_WHILE;
whl->base.next = NULL;
whl->base.offset = while_token->offset;
whl->base.length = ctx->token->offset + ctx->token->length - while_token->offset;
whl->condition = condition;
whl->body = body;
}
return (Node*) whl;
}
static Node *parse_dowhile_statement(Context *ctx)
{
assert(ctx != NULL);
if(done(ctx))
{
Error_Report(ctx->error, 0, "Source ended where a do-while statement was expected");
return NULL;
}
if(current(ctx) != TKWDO)
{
Error_Report(ctx->error, 0, "Got unexpected token \"%.*s\" where a do-while statement was expected", ctx->token->length, ctx->src + ctx->token->offset);
return NULL;
}
Token *do_token = current_token(ctx);
assert(do_token != NULL);
next(ctx); // Consume the "do" keyword.
Node *body = parse_statement(ctx);
if(body == NULL)
return NULL;
if(done(ctx))
{
Error_Report(ctx->error, 0, "Source ended right after a do-while body, where the \"while\" keyword was expected");
return NULL;
}
if(current(ctx) != TKWWHILE)
{
Error_Report(ctx->error, 0, "Got unexpected token \"%.*s\" after a do-while body, where the \"while\" keyword was expected", ctx->token->length, ctx->src + ctx->token->offset);
return NULL;
}
next(ctx); // Consume the "while" keyword.
Node *condition = parse_expression(ctx);
if(condition == NULL)
return NULL;
if(done(ctx))
{
Error_Report(ctx->error, 0, "Source ended right after a do-while condition, where a ';' was expected");
return NULL;
}
if(current(ctx) != ';')
{
Error_Report(ctx->error, 0, "Got unexpected token \"%.*s\" after a do-while conditnion, where a ';' was expected", ctx->token->length, ctx->src + ctx->token->offset);
return NULL;
}
next(ctx); // Skip the ';'.
DoWhileNode *dowhl;
{
dowhl = BPAlloc_Malloc(ctx->alloc, sizeof(DoWhileNode));
if(dowhl == NULL)
{
// ERROR: No memory.
Error_Report(ctx->error, 1, "No memory");
return NULL;
}
dowhl->base.kind = NODE_DOWHILE;
dowhl->base.next = NULL;
dowhl->base.offset = do_token->offset;
dowhl->base.length = ctx->token->offset + ctx->token->length - do_token->offset;
dowhl->condition = condition;
dowhl->body = body;
}
return (Node*) dowhl;
}
